When I smoke pork shoulder I usually do two shoulders and place them on the top rack.

I need to do four.

Will adding two more shoulders to the bottom rack add to the cooking time?

Thanks
 
Not enough to notice.

If time is an issue, you as the pitmaster have tools you can put to use as needed. Increased cooking temperature is one. Foiling is another. Use as needed.
 
Not really, you might notice a tad longer time to come back up to temp after putting double the amount of cold meat into it, but cooking will be the same. The real questions is if you put butt on the bottom, where ya going to put the beans? :D
 
Yes. It will add time and use more charcoal. That's why there is a side door. Add unlit coals as needed. Don't wait for the temp to drop below 200 before adding more coals.
